Telugu Desam Party (TDP) leaders, on Friday, alleged that the State government had forgotten to implement the welfare schemes taken up for the benefit of the poor and the downtrodden.
Talking to media persons, TDP MLAs Sandra Venkata Veeraiah and Seethakka alleged that the government had totally failed in implementation of welfare measures taken up by former chief minister, the late YS Rajasekhara Reddy, for the benefit of the downtrodden.
The TDP leaders accused the Congress leaders of being focussed only on the Odarpu yatra of Kadapa MP YS Jaganmohan Reddy and the Telangana statehood issue.
The members wondered who would bring around development in the State if the government concentrated only on Odarpu yatra and Telangana issue.
The TDP leaders further alleged that the funds allotted for the welfare schemes and students' hostels were being diverted for other schemes.
The opposition leaders said that the funds allotted to Dalits' welfare were used for construction of roads in Pulivendula in YSR district and demanded explanation from the government regarding its silence on the diversion of the funds allotted to SC/STs.
The TDP leaders also questioned why the Governor ESL Narasimhan had become a mute spectator when the Rs. 8,000 crore funds released under sub-plan were being diverted to other works.
